HER Number:MDV126779
Name:Combe Martin Pound

Summary

The triangle of land by the parish church in which the war memorial now stands was formerly the site of the village pound.

Full description

Claughton, P. + Paynter, S. + Dunkerley, T., 2005, Further Work on Residues From Lead/Silver Smelting at Combe Martin, North Devon (Poster). SDV351630.

Where the war memorial now stands was, prior to 1909, the village pound. It is recorded as 'waste' in the 1842 Tithe Assessment. The pound formerly extended further eastward until the cutting of the turnpike road in 1832, at which time the east side of the pound became part of Middleton.

Ordnance Survey, 2019, MasterMap 2019 (Cartographic). SDV362729.

The war memorial stands in a triangular plot of land.
